Transaction 4a7aae8447cc040cafc0621dac5d86aec4b62806a29268789ac5cb7f26a68630

62 Input
2 Outputs
  • 4a7aae8447cc040cafc0621dac5d86aec4b62806a29268789ac5cb7f26a68630:0
  • value  594735
    address  3NKHyjaNDBDfMW3grqbEDWE5aDUpTpZSP6
  • 4a7aae8447cc040cafc0621dac5d86aec4b62806a29268789ac5cb7f26a68630:1
  • value  9470379197
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s